What New Jersey Employers Look For
The qualifications that appear most often in technical program manager jobs across New Jersey.
- Bachelor's degree in computer science, engineering, or a related technical field
- 5 or more years managing large-scale, cross-functional technical programs end to end
- Proficiency with program management tools such as Jira, Confluence, or Asana
- Experience driving alignment across engineering, product, and executive stakeholders
- PMP, PgMP, or equivalent program management certification preferred
- Familiarity with agile and waterfall delivery methodologies in a software environment

How much do technical program managers make in New Jersey?
Technical program managers in New Jersey earn a median of about $203,460 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$137,070 for the lowest 10% to over $294,110 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.
